Amendment Since initial award the total obligations have increased 401% from $841,459 to $4,219,302.
Dana-Farber Cancer Institute was awarded Molecular and immune drivers of immunotherapy responsiveness in prostate cancer Cooperative Agreement U01CA233100 worth $4,219,302 from National Cancer Institute in September 2018 with work to be completed primarily in Boston Massachusetts United States. The grant has a duration of 5 years and was awarded through assistance program 93.353 21st Century Cures Act - Beau Biden Cancer Moonshot. The Cooperative Agreement was awarded through grant opportunity Immuno-Oncology Translational Network (IOTN): Cancer Immunotherapy Research Projects (U01).
